Herbicides containing substituted thien-3-yl-sulphonylamino(thio)carbonyl-triazolin(ethi)ones
View Patent ↗The invention relates to herbicidal compositions, their preparation, and their use for controlling unwanted vegetation. The compositions include an effective amount of an active compound combination that includes: (a) a substituted thien-3-yl-sulphonylaminocarbonyltriazolinone of formula (I-2) or salts thereof; and (b) at least one of the known herbicides listed in the disclosure and, (c) optionally a safener.
1. A herbicidal composition comprising an active compound combination comprising:
(a) a substituted thien-3-yl-sulphonylaminocarbonyltriazolinone of formula (I-2)
or salts thereof; and
(b) atrazine; and
(c) optionally a compound that improves compatibility with crop plants selected from the group consisting of: AD-67, BAS-145138, benoxacor, cloquintocet-mexyl, cyometrinil, DKA-24, dichlormid, dymron, fenclorim, fenchlorazol-ethyl, flurazole, fluxofenim, furilazole, isoxadifen-ethyl, MCPA, mecoprop, mefenpyr-diethyl, MG-191, oxabetrinil, PPG-1292, R-29148, N-cyclopropyl-4-[[(2-methoxy-5-methylbenzoyl)amino]sulphonyl]benzamide, N-[[(4-methoxyacetylamino)phenyl]sulphonyl]-2-methoxybenzamide, and N-[[(4-methylamino-carbonylamino)phenyl]sulphonyl]-2-methoxybenzamid;
wherein the weight ratio of the compound (a) of formula (I-2) to the compound (b) is from 1:0.001 to 1:1000.
2. The composition according to claim 1 , wherein at least one compound (c) is included.
3. The composition according to claim 2 , wherein the compound (c) comprises at least one compound selected from the group consisting of cloquintocet-mexyl, isoxadifen-ethyl, mefenpyr-diethyl, AD-67, BAS-145138, benoxacor, dichlormide, furilazole, and R-29148.
